Find the unit rate 12 chocolate bars cost $18 how much for 1

To find the unit rate we need to divide the the total cost of the bars by the number of bars bought. On this case we have:


\text{rate}=(18)/(12)=1.5\text{ \$ per bars}

On this case each bar costs $ 1.5
